The story

Founded in 2019 as a data-driven cyber insurer for SMBs, Cowbell differentiated via continuous underwriting (Cowbell Factors) and direct API integrations with security tooling. The company expanded from a US-focused SMB insurer to a multi-geography specialty insurer (UK, India) targeting mid-market as well. In 2026, Cowbell pivoted its product narrative around OMNI, an AI-native decision intelligence layer, repositioning itself as an AI-first specialty insurance platform rather than just a cyber insurtech—moving underwriting, claims, and resilience into a single agentic system.

Product timeline
2019
Founded in Pleasanton, California by Jack Kudale to provide adaptive cyber insurance for SMBs.· insurance
2020
Launched commercial sales of Cowbell cyber insurance products, building a network of over 4,000 agents and brokers.· insurance
2021
Raised $20M Series A; joined AWS Partner Program and passed AWS Foundational Technical Review.· pivot
2022
Raised $100M Series B; partnered with iBynd for embedded cyber insurance distribution to SMBs via broker and MSSP channels.· insurance
2023
Launched Cowbell UK entity in London, expanding to UK SME market with cyber and professional indemnity products.· insurance
2024
Raised $60M Series C led by Zurich Insurance Group; expanded internationally including India operations.· insurance
2026
Launched OMNI, an AI-native Decision Intelligence System for underwriting, claims, and resilience across the insurance lifecycle.· pivot
